Simplifying 4x + 6y = 148 Solving 4x + 6y = 148 Solving for variable 'x'. Move all terms containing x to the left, all other terms to the right. Add '-6y' to each side of the equation. 4x + 6y + -6y = 148 + -6y Combine like terms: 6y + -6y = 0 4x + 0 = 148 + -6y 4x = 148 + -6y Divide each side by '4'. x = 37 + -1.5y Simplifying x = 37 + -1.5y
